Output 669601edb251e99bafba967296a5963bf81fa493b18ea326aa2156478dc67e5f:0

value
24378000
script pubkey
OP_0 OP_PUSHBYTES_20 aaa8c58e4edf75baa28a90cb323d1fbb3e8d1a74
address
ltc1q425vtrjwma6m4g52jr9ny0glhvlg6xn5jahksp
transaction
669601edb251e99bafba967296a5963bf81fa493b18ea326aa2156478dc67e5f
spent
true